Been wondering about remaping a stock ECM. After the ECM is down loaded with a new map, such as from a TTS Master tune, Is there a chance that it could loose it's map or memory later on down the road, or do they tell you to keep the interface with the bike for tuning purposes. Has anyone, or do you know of anyone having a problem like this ?

rule of thumb is if you head out of town, take the TTS (or whatever tuning device it is) with you. This way if you break down and have to get to a HD shop, 1) you can revert back to the stock map if needed and 2) in case the ECM does lose it's mapping, you can reload your tuned map.

Yes it is very possible for the ECM to lose it's mapping and need to be reloaded. Hasn't happened to me but I've seen and read where it's happened to others.
